Mesothelioma Lawyer - How a Mesothelioma Lawyer Can Help

A mesothelioma lawyer can help victims and families to file an action. The compensation from mesothelioma lawsuits could cover a variety of losses including medical expenses, lost wages, and pain and suffering.

Victims must act swiftly as the statutes of limitations vary. They should also seek out an experienced attorney who specializes in asbestos cases and has been awarded national awards.

Lost Earning Capacity

A mesothelioma diagnosis could affect the entire family. The mesothelioma-related symptoms can hinder patients from working. This could force the family to find alternatives to survive. A successful lawsuit can help offset these costs.

A mesothelioma lawyer can assist patients and their families to comprehend the various forms of compensation they could be entitled to. This includes both compensation awards and non-compensatory ones. Compensation for lost earnings or lost earning potential can be significant. Additionally, many mesothelioma lawsuits and trust fund awards are tax-free.

Lawyers who specialize in mesothelioma know that a diagnosis can be a stressful experience. That's why mesothelioma law firms (just click the following page) handle the legal details for their clients, allowing them to focus on their health and family members.

A mesothelioma lawyer with experience will bring a personal injury lawsuit for asbestos patients seeking compensation for medical expenses as well as pain and suffering and other expenses due to the illness. Additionally the claim for wrongful death can be filed on behalf of loved family members who have passed away due to mesothelioma. This type of claim could seek compensation for funeral expenses, a loss of companionship or consortium and the loss of support and services.

A mesothelioma suit can be settled at any point after it is filed. This is possible in order to avoid expensive litigation which could delay justice for the plaintiff or their loved family members. A mesothelioma settlement can ensure that asbestos companies and past employers are held accountable for their harm. Each mesothelioma case patient will be awarded a different amount of compensation.

Suffering and Pain

Pain and suffering is the legal term used to describe the emotional and physical stress caused by an injury that is serious. Asbestos exposure could cause mesothelioma patients to be entitled to compensation. A lawsuit can aid victims, their families, and the government offset costs like medical bills, funeral expenses and lost earnings due to mesothelioma-related treatments.

A mesothelioma lawyer can help victims understand the different types of compensation they could be eligible for. Compensation can be obtained through a personal injury lawsuit or wrongful death lawsuit. An experienced mesothelioma law firm can help victims decide which type of claim is best for their particular situation.

The first step to file mesothelioma lawsuits is to obtain medical records that show mesothelioma diagnoses. A mesothelioma lawyer can help with locating these records and requesting them from appropriate medical facilities.

Patients suffering from mesothelioma should undergo several tests to diagnose the disease and determine their best treatment. These tests could include a chest CT, MRI or PET scan, and the biopsy. In a biopsy, doctors remove a small amount of tissue from the affected area to test for mesothelioma. In this procedure, patients are usually in pain. The biopsy can be carried out using VATS (video-assisted surgical thoracoscopic procedure), keyhole surgery, or a CT-guided needle biopsy.

Victims must discuss all of their treatment options with a mesothelioma specialist. This will ensure that they can make the best decisions for their health and well-being. Discussing with doctors about possible side effects and the goals of each treatment option is important.

Medical Costs

The cost of treatment for mesothelioma can be more than many families can afford. The legal team at Sokolove Law assists patients and their families receive compensation that can help offset expected and unexpected costs associated with the cancer.

Mesothelioma-related medical costs can include chemotherapy sessions, hospitalizations, and surgery. These are the most common expenses, but mesothelioma patients may also face a range of other costs. These can include travel to specialists, caregivers, lodging near hospitals, and much more.

A lot of patients with mesothelioma qualify to receive financial aid through government programs. These include Medicaid, Medicare, Social Security Disability Insurance and veteran benefits. Mesothelioma suits can also provide compensation. Compensation may be awarded in the form a settlement or verdict. Settlements are quicker and less stressful process than bringing a case to trial. Trust funds for mesothelioma which are created by businesses who have declared bankruptcy, can provide compensation to victims.

Health insurance may cover a portion mesothelioma treatment However, patients must carefully review their coverage to understand the deductibles, out-of-pocket limits and more. Patients should keep track of their expenses and insurance claims to settle any disputes or mistakes.

Asbestos victims may also be eligible for reduced or no-cost treatment through the VA. Veterans who have been exposed to asbestos during their military service may be eligible for compensation as part of their VA benefits package. Mesothelioma lawyers can assist veterans in completing their VA paperwork and submitting mesothelioma claims. They can also assist in seeking other forms of government compensation. Certain companies that are responsible for asbestos exposure have set up trust funds to compensate mesothelioma victims as well as their families.

Lost Wages

A mesothelioma diagnosis may make it difficult to focus on work. Mesothelioma victims may receive compensation for their lost wages. This includes both past and future losses. Compensation may also help pay for living expenses and other costs.

A reliable law firm with a reputation for excellence that specializes in mesothelioma can examine your case and determine the best path to take. The top firms offer free consultations for potential clients. These consultations aren't a sales pitch but a chance to find out more about your options and to meet a lawyer. Consultations are also an opportunity to ask about the firm's expertise and track record. Top lawyers take cases on an on a contingency basis, which means they only receive compensation if they are successful in obtaining compensation for you or your loved one.

Mesothelioma litigation can take years to settle or verdict award. The timeline depends on many factors, including the time limit, which can vary by state and type of claim. Some defendants are willing to settle before trial in order to receive financial benefits, and avoid the expense of court and negative publicity.

Asbestos suits can be filed in state and federal courts, and multiple defendants could be involved. Compensation from a lawsuit can include both monetary compensation and other forms of support, like help with transportation and home treatment. Patients and their families with mesothelioma can also apply for disability benefits through the Department of Veterans Affairs, or private insurance companies like Medicare and Medicaid. A mesothelioma lawyer can assist asbestos patients make the right types of claims and determine the best course of action is for their specific situation. The most experienced mesothelioma lawyers are able to explain to clients all their legal options and how they affect their compensation.

Damages

A mesothelioma attorney can assist a victim or loved relatives file an asbestos lawsuit against the responsible asbestos companies. Compensation in a mesothelioma suit can help victims cover treatment costs as well as replace income lost and provide their families with financial stability. Compensation may include additional damages, such as emotional trauma as well as discomfort and pain, and much more.

A top mesothelioma settlement law firm will review a client's unique circumstances and determine which type of claim to file. Mesothelioma lawsuits fall into one of three categories: personal injury lawsuits and wrongful death claims, as well as trust fund claims.

Personal injury lawsuits are based on the belief that an asbestos-related illness or injury is directly connected to the negligence of the defendant. A lawyer who has handled many mesothelioma cases can demonstrate this connection using medical evidence, witness testimony and other legal sources.

The wrongful death claim seeks compensation for the estate of a deceased mesothelioma patient, typically their spouse or children. Like a personal injury claim, a wrongful death lawsuit may be filed against a variety of parties and resolved through a settlement or a trial verdict.

A mesothelioma attorney's past success in these kinds of cases can assist a client get the best settlement. Attorneys who have won multiple jury verdicts in mesothelioma cases can utilize this experience to bargain with asbestos-related companies. They can negotiate an agreement that is larger and more accurately represents the total losses of a victim, and also provide their loved ones a stable future. A reputable mesothelioma lawyer will work on a contingency basis to ensure there is no financial risk associated with making legal proceedings.
